MAUNGANUI LEAVES MELBOURNE. Cabled advice has been received, by the Union Company that the Maunganui left Melbourne at 10.30 a.m. yesterday for Bluff, Dunedin, Lyttelton and XVellington. She is due at Bluff next Sunday and here on December 23.

PORT TAURANGA WITH HARDWOOD. "With a cargo of hardwood, the Watchlln Line motor-ship Port Tauranga is due at ■Wellington at 7 a.m. to-day from tofts Harbour and will berth at the Pipltea Wharf. She is to leave here again to-night for Auckland to complete discharge. RANGITATA IN PORT. To complete her Homeward loading the New Zealand Shipping Company’s motorliner Rangitata is duo at 'Wellington this morning from Auckland, and will berth at the Glasgow Wharf. She is to clear this port filially next Tuesday for London, via the Panama Canal. PORT HUNTER DUE TO-DAY. To continue her Homeward loading the Port Line steamer Port Hunter is due at Wellington about noon to-day from Auckland. aud will berth at the Glasgow Wharf. She Is to leave here again next Tuesday for Napier to till up and is now scheduled to clear that port finally on December 28 for London, Avonmouth, Liverpool and Glasgow, via the Panama Canal.
